- Thanksgiving 2025 is on Thursday, November 27.
- Many major stores, including Costco, Walmart, and Target, will be closed on Thanksgiving this year.
- However, other major chains will be open under modified hours.
As families across the country gather for Thanksgiving feasts and other celebrations, many major retailers will also be taking the day off.
Big-box stores like Costco, Walmart, and Target all plan to be closed for the holiday, while a few grocery and retail chains will remain open for any last-minute essentials.
Here are 16 major chain stores that will be open on Thanksgiving, as well as 20 that will be closed.

Most major retail chains will be closed on Thanksgiving.

The major chain stores that will be closed on Thanksgiving 2025 are:
- Aldi
- Belk
- Best Buy
- BJ’s Wholesale Club
- Costco
- Dick’s Sporting Goods
- Home Depot
- Ikea
- Kohl’s
- Lowe’s
- Macy’s
- Nordstrom
- Publix
- Sam’s Club
- Sephora
- Target
- T.J. Maxx, Marshalls, HomeGoods, and Sierra
- Trader Joe’s
- Ulta
- Walmart
